What is Psalms 16:5 about?
This verse speaks to the deep and personal relationship we have with God. When the psalmist says, “The Lord is my chosen portion and my cup,” it is a declaration of complete trust and reliance on God as the ultimate provider and sustainer of our lives. The psalmist chooses God above all else as the most important and satisfying aspect of their life, just as we carefully choose our favorite food or drink. This verse reminds us that our true fulfillment and satisfaction can only be found in God.
Furthermore, when the psalmist acknowledges, “you hold my lot,” it points to the belief that God is in control of our destiny and knows what is best for us. This verse serves as a comforting reminder that God has a plan for us and is guiding our steps in times of uncertainty or hardship. It prompts us to surrender our fears and concerns to God, trusting that He is working all things together for our good. Understanding what Psalms 16:5 really means
The Book of Psalms stands as a treasure trove of songs, prayers, and poems that encapsulate the diverse spectrum of human emotions and experiences. Among these, Psalm 16 emerges as a Miktam of David, a heartfelt expression of confidence and trust in God. Delving into the historical and cultural backdrop of this psalm, we immerse ourselves in the life of David, a man after God’s own heart, whose intimate relationship with the Divine permeates the verses of Psalm 16. At its core, this psalm resonates with the theme of finding security and joy in the presence of God, a timeless truth that transcends generations.
“The Lord is my chosen portion and my cup,” a poignant declaration that encapsulates the essence of reliance on God for sustenance and blessings. This phrase paints a vivid picture of God as the ultimate provider, whose abundance overflows into the lives of His children. Drawing parallels with Psalm 23:5, where God’s provision is likened to a table overflowing with goodness, we grasp the depth of God’s care for His people. Moving on to the assertion, “You hold my lot,” we encounter the profound truth of God’s sovereignty and authority over every aspect of our lives. Just as Proverbs 16:33 affirms that even the seemingly random casting of lots is under God’s divine control, so too is our destiny in His hands.
